

Frankie was a longtime Las Vegas resident known for his charm, wit, and love of life, passed away peacefully on October 10, 2025, at the age of 76.
Born on February 2, 1949, in Niagara Falls, New York, Frankie moved to Las Vegas in the 60's, where he built a remarkable career in the city’s legendary casino industry. Over the years, he worked as a pit boss at some of the Strip’s most iconic establishments, including "The Dunes" and "MGM Grand". His professionalism and larger-than-life personality made him a beloved figure among colleagues and guests alike.
Outside of work, Frankie had an undeniable zest for life. He traveled the world, always seeking new adventures and experiences. He was also known for his love of entertaining—his home was often the center of laughter-filled gatherings, especially during the holidays, which he decorated for with joy and flair.
Though he never married and had no children, Frankie’s circle of friends became his family, and his generous spirit left a lasting impact on all who knew him. He was preceded in death by his parents, Frank Meranto Sr. and Ann Meranto.
Frankie will be remembered for his warm smile, his storytelling, and the sparkle he brought to every room he entered. His memory will live on in the hearts of those fortunate enough to have shared in his journey.
